Go on a discovery tour of Kristiansand. Discover the most important and famous locations of the city.

Search for the city's treasures with your family or friends. Can you complete the assignments? Will you get the top score in the city?

This E-scavenger hunt and online city game will give you a fantastic day in Kristiansand. Play in 1 team or in small teams against each other. Decide for yourself when you start, pause and end. It's your party only and you'll get to know the city in a unique way.

Instructions for starting the tour will be given after booking. You can do this tour whenever you choose.

Itinerary

  • Odderoya

    Odderøya in Kristiansand was the former naval base - now recreational area. Marked picturesque paths, old cannon positions and small beaches.

  • Kristiansand Domkirke

    The Cathedral Church in Kristiansand is one of the largest churches in Norway, measured by the number of seats.

  • Kristiansand Tourist Information

    On the market square there is also the information center in an original building next to the town hall.

  • Fiskebrygga

    Well worth a visit for anyone in Kristiansand. Local fish market with fresh fish, oysters, crab, lobsters, mussels, of course fresh salmon

  • Otterdalsparken

    On this beautiful boulevard, you have a picturesque view of the marina and the picturesque coastline.

  • Kilden Performing Arts Centre

    Kilden, a theatre and concert hall in Kristiansand, Norway, has brought together all the city's institutions of performing arts in a beautiful and modern building.

  • Posebyen

    Every visit to Kristiansand includes a wonderful walk past the historic white houses of Posebyen. The Posebyen district is more than 300 years old.

  • Christiansholm Festning

    Kristiansand fortress was finished in 1672 and formed a part of King Christian IV's plan for defense of Kristiansand when the city was founded in 1641.

  • Kristiansand City Hall

    Kristiansand Town Hall is located on the top square in Kristiansand. The town hall houses the council chamber and meeting rooms. The city Council.

  • Port of Kristiansand

    Large cruise ships dock here and the passengers then enter the nice center. a pleasant hustle and bustle.

  • Agder Kunstsenter

    They sell graphic art, pottery, jewellery and glass, etc. In addition they have temporary exhibitions of the work of local and national artists.
